Te Whānau o Te Puna Reo o Ritimana Presents: Waiata Mai - Te Puna Reo O Ritimana Fundraiser

Nau mai, haere mai e hoa mā! Te Wiki o te Reo Māori 2024 brings us together for a fundraising event in support of Te Puna Reo o Ritimana, and celebrate te Reo Māori revitalisation.
Featuring performances from Anna Coddington, Mohi, Jordyn with a Why, and Geneva AM, with Moana Maniapoto as Special Guest MC.

In celebration of Te Wiki o te Reo Māori 2024, Te Whānau o Te Puna Reo o Ritimana is proud to present a night of waiata Māori, bringing together some of Aotearoa’s most talented artists. The event will take place on Friday 20 September at The Tuning Fork and feature performances from some of the biggest stars of the Aotearoa music scene, including Anna Coddington, Mohi, Jordyn with a Why, and Geneva AM, with the iconic Moana Maniapoto as the special guest MC.

This special evening is not just a celebration of waiata Māori and te reo Māori... the main kaupapa is to fundraise for Te Puna Reo o Ritimana, a total immersion Māori-medium early childhood center in Ponsonby that was established in 1985.

Artist Geneva AM, who attended Ritimana in 1993 reflects on her time there:
Looking back at my time at Ritimana, I feel incredibly fortunate to have begun my early education in an environment that focused on Te Ao Māori. The pathway that this early decision set me on has empowered me in countless ways, shaping my music and guiding me as a mother. I am so grateful Kōhanga and Puna Reo centres like Ritimana have grown to become places of total reo immersion learning, making it easier for the next generations of whānau to access and embrace these enriching environments.
All proceeds will go directly towards supporting resources and maintaining the wharekura, ensuring an enriching environment for our tamariki.
